All Downloads are FREE. Search and download functionalities are using the official Maven repository.

kotlinx.serialization.json.Json.class Maven / Gradle / Ivy

????2?kotlinx/serialization/json/Jsonjava/lang/Object"kotlinx/serialization/StringFormatb(Lkotlinx/serialization/json/JsonConfiguration;Lkotlinx/serialization/modules/SerializersModule;)V()V	


configuration.Lkotlinx/serialization/json/JsonConfiguration;
	serializersModule1Lkotlinx/serialization/modules/SerializersModule;	9kotlinx/serialization/json/internal/DescriptorSchemaCache

_schemaCache;Lkotlinx/serialization/json/internal/DescriptorSchemaCache;	this!Lkotlinx/serialization/json/Json;getConfiguration0()Lkotlinx/serialization/json/JsonConfiguration;#Lorg/jetbrains/annotations/NotNull;getSerializersModule3()Lkotlinx/serialization/modules/SerializersModule;*get_schemaCache$kotlinx_serialization_json=()Lkotlinx/serialization/json/internal/DescriptorSchemaCache;6get_schemaCache$kotlinx_serialization_json$annotationsLkotlin/Deprecated;messageFShould not be accessed directly, use Json.schemaCache accessor insteadreplaceWithLkotlin/ReplaceWith;
expressionschemaCacheimportslevelLkotlin/DeprecationLevel;ERRORencodeToStringS(Lkotlinx/serialization/SerializationStrategy;Ljava/lang/Object;)Ljava/lang/String;`(Lkotlinx/serialization/SerializationStrategy<-TT;>;TT;)Ljava/lang/String;
serializer3kotlin/jvm/internal/Intrinsics5checkNotNullParameter'(Ljava/lang/Object;Ljava/lang/String;)V78
695kotlinx/serialization/json/internal/JsonStringBuilder;
<
8kotlinx/serialization/json/internal/StreamingJsonEncoder>-kotlinx/serialization/json/internal/WriteMode@OBJ/Lkotlinx/serialization/json/internal/WriteMode;BC	ADvalues2()[Lkotlinx/serialization/json/internal/WriteMode;FG
AH&kotlinx/serialization/json/JsonEncoderJ?(Lkotlinx/serialization/json/internal/JsonStringBuilder;Lkotlinx/serialization/json/Json;Lkotlinx/serialization/json/internal/WriteMode;[Lkotlinx/serialization/json/JsonEncoder;)VL
?MencodeSerializableValueB(Lkotlinx/serialization/SerializationStrategy;Ljava/lang/Object;)VOP
?QtoString()Ljava/lang/String;ST
<UreleaseW	
<Xencoder:Lkotlinx/serialization/json/internal/StreamingJsonEncoder;result7Lkotlinx/serialization/json/internal/JsonStringBuilder;-Lkotlinx/serialization/SerializationStrategy;valueLjava/lang/Object;+kotlinx/serialization/SerializationStrategyajava/lang/ThrowablecdecodeFromStringU(Lkotlinx/serialization/DeserializationStrategy;Ljava/lang/String;)Ljava/lang/Object;a(Lkotlinx/serialization/DeserializationStrategy;Ljava/lang/String;)TT;deserializerhstringj3kotlinx/serialization/json/internal/StringJsonLexerl(Ljava/lang/String;)Vn
mo8kotlinx/serialization/json/internal/StreamingJsonDecoderq5kotlinx/serialization/json/internal/AbstractJsonLexers-kotlinx/serialization/DeserializationStrategyu
getDescriptor6()Lkotlinx/serialization/descriptors/SerialDescriptor;wxvy?(Lkotlinx/serialization/json/Json;Lkotlinx/serialization/json/internal/WriteMode;Lkotlinx/serialization/json/internal/AbstractJsonLexer;Lkotlinx/serialization/descriptors/SerialDescriptor;)V{
r|decodeSerializableValueC(Lkotlinx/serialization/DeserializationStrategy;)Ljava/lang/Object;~
r?	expectEof?	
m?lexer5Lkotlinx/serialization/json/internal/StringJsonLexer;input:Lkotlinx/serialization/json/internal/StreamingJsonDecoder;/Lkotlinx/serialization/DeserializationStrategy;Ljava/lang/String;encodeToJsonElementi(Lkotlinx/serialization/SerializationStrategy;Ljava/lang/Object;)Lkotlinx/serialization/json/JsonElement;v(Lkotlinx/serialization/SerializationStrategy<-TT;>;TT;)Lkotlinx/serialization/json/JsonElement;5kotlinx/serialization/json/internal/TreeJsonEncoderKt?	writeJson?(Lkotlinx/serialization/json/Json;Ljava/lang/Object;Lkotlinx/serialization/SerializationStrategy;)Lkotlinx/serialization/json/JsonElement;??
??decodeFromJsonElementk(Lkotlinx/serialization/DeserializationStrategy;Lkotlinx/serialization/json/JsonElement;)Ljava/lang/Object;w(Lkotlinx/serialization/DeserializationStrategy;Lkotlinx/serialization/json/JsonElement;)TT;element?5kotlinx/serialization/json/internal/TreeJsonDecoderKt?readJson?(Lkotlinx/serialization/json/Json;Lkotlinx/serialization/json/JsonElement;Lkotlinx/serialization/DeserializationStrategy;)Ljava/lang/Object;??
??(Lkotlinx/serialization/json/JsonElement;parseToJsonElement<(Ljava/lang/String;)Lkotlinx/serialization/json/JsonElement;0kotlinx/serialization/json/JsonElementSerializer?INSTANCE2Lkotlinx/serialization/json/JsonElementSerializer;??	??ef
?&kotlinx/serialization/json/JsonElement??(Lkotlinx/serialization/json/JsonConfiguration;Lkotlinx/serialization/modules/SerializersModule;Lkotlin/jvm/internal/DefaultConstructorMarker;)V
?$constructor_marker.Lkotlin/jvm/internal/DefaultConstructorMarker;'kotlinx/serialization/json/Json$Default?1(Lkotlin/jvm/internal/DefaultConstructorMarker;)V?
??Default)Lkotlinx/serialization/json/Json$Default;??	?Lkotlin/Metadata;mvkxi0d1???H


??

??





??








??6?? $20:$B00¢J'H"??2H020¢J'H"??2H020¢J'0"??2H02H¢ J'!0"??2H02H¢"J#020R08??X¢
??	
R0¢
??
R0X–¢
??‚%&¨'d2$Lkotlinx/serialization/StringFormat;T%Lkotlinx/serialization/json/JsonImpl;kotlinx-serialization-jsonJson.ktRuntimeInvisibleAnnotations
DeprecatedCodeLineNumberTableLocalVariableTableRuntimeVisibleAnnotations
StackMapTable	Signature$RuntimeInvisibleParameterAnnotationsInnerClasses
SourceFile!???
?????h*?*+?*,?*?Y????57	8@6? 
?/*???7?? !?/*???8??"#?/*???@???	$	?
???#%&s'(@)*s+,[-e./01??A+4?:?$
Z[5Z[3\]AA3^A_`?2??	ef??;+i?:,k?:?mY,?pN?rY*?E-?t+?z?}:+??:-????bc,d4e8f?>&??,??4\`;;h?;j??g?
???K
+4?:*,+????n? 

3^
_`????	???Q+i?:,??:*,+????w? h??????
???I+k?:*???v+????????j?????C*+,????*
???	???Y??????
????????[I?I?I??I??I??[s??[(ss?ss
ssssss$s	s"s#sss s!s?s?shs?s?s?s?sesjs?sfs?s3s^s_s?s0s1s?s?s?s?s?




© 2015 - 2025 Weber Informatics LLC | Privacy Policy